Infections
Chronic infections may be associated with a dementia-like condition. Conditions such as
borrelioses, neurosyphilis and HIV can lead to dementia and should be considered when the
patient's lifestyle or history indicates risk. AIDS-related dementia is probably a direct
consequence of HIV infecting the central nervous system (CNS)
Normal pressure
hydrocephalus
This is a brain potentially reversible disorder caused by blockage of the flow of the CSF. It
leads to enlargement of the ventricles and compression of brain tissue. As a result brain
atrophy and dementia can occur. Structural brain imaging techniques such as CT scanning can
establish whether this disease has caused the dementia

The pathogenesis of AD is poorly understood
Pathways believed to contribute to neuronal dysfunction and death include:
–Decreased acetylcholine synthesis and impaired cholinergic function
–Glutamatergic excitotoxicity
–Direct toxicity of β−amyloid peptide
–Mitochondrial dysfunction
–Increased oxidative stress
–Activation of apoptotic pathways
–Release of inflammatory mediators
–Impaired calcium signalling and regulation
•These pathways represent targets for existing and novel AD therapies
Pathogenesis of Alzheimer’s Disease

*Vascular dementia is the second most
common cause of dementia, after
Alzheimer's disease.
*It accounts for up to 20 % of all
dementias and is caused by brain
damage from cerebrovascular or
cardiovascular problems - usually
strokes.
*It also may result from genetic
diseases, endocarditis or amyloid
angiopathy.
*It may coexist with Alzheimer's
disease.
*Unlike people with Alzheimer's
disease, people with vascular
dementia often maintain their
personality and normal levels of
emotional responsiveness until the
later stages of the disease.
*People with vascular dementia
frequently wander at night and often
have other problems commonly
found in people who have had a
stroke, including depression and
incontinence.
In Lewy body dementia, cells die in the brain's
cortex , and the substantia nigra. Many of the
remaining nerve cells in the substantia nigra
contain abnormal structures called Lewy
bodies that are the hallmark of the disease.
The symptoms of Lewy body dementia
overlap with Alzheimer's disease in many ways
and may include memory impairment, poor
judgment, and confusion.
Lewy body dementia typically also includes
visual hallucinations, parkinsonian symptoms
such as a shuffling gait (walk) and flexed
posture, and day-to-day fluctuations in the
severity of symptoms.
Patients with Lewy body dementia live an
average of 7 years after symptoms begin.
There is no cure for Lewy body dementia, and
treatments are aimed at controlling the
parkinsonian and psychiatric symptoms of the
disorder.
Rivastigmine can be used to manage
symptoms.

*CT (to exclude intracranial lesions; cerebral infarction and
haemorrhage; extradural and subdural haematomas; normal
pressure hydrocephalus)
*MRI (sensitive indicator of cerebrovascular disease, higher
resolution to detect focal atrophy—for example, in hippocampal
area)
*SPECT (to assess regional blood flow and dopamine scan to
detect Lewy body disease)
*PET CT
*Carotid ultrasonography (if large vessel atherosclerosis is
suspected)
*Electroencephalography is not part of routine investigations but
can be useful if epilepsy or an encephalopathy is suspected
In secondary care

*Pharmacological
*Anticholinesterase inhibitors (Donepezil, Galantamine, Rivastigmine)
*Enhance cholinergic neurotransmission by delaying breakdown of Ach
*Licensed for mild to moderate AD
*Side effects: GI upset, GI ulceration, headache, sleep disturbance, bradycardias
*Memantine
*Excessive activation of the NMDA (N-methyl-D-aspartate) receptor by glutamate may contribute
to destruction of cholinergic neurones
*NMDA antagonist
*Licensed for moderate to severe AD
*Side effects: headaches, fatigue, hallucinations, constipation

*These include older antipsychotic drugs (e.g. halopeirdol) or newer medications (e.g.
quetiapine, olanzapine, risperidone, amisulpride, aripiprazole)
*Side effects: greater in older people - increased stroke risk, increased cardiovascular
risk, Parkinsonian side effects, falls, additional deaths
*These are class effects, not limited to one particular drug
*Not licensed for the treatment of agitation (except risperidone)
*20-30% of people in nursing homes with dementia are on an antipsychotic
*NHS survey 2007/8: 5.3% of people over 65 are prescribed an antipsychotic
*These drugs are often inappropriately prescribed to ‘control’ BPSD
Antipsychotics used in dementia

*Pharmacological agents used only in severe dementia with severe
non-cognitive symptoms
*Discussion with the person with dementia and/or carers about
benefits/risks of treatment.
*Monitor cognition at regular intervals.
*Target symptoms should be identified, quantified and documented.
*Exclude/treat depression
*The dose should be low initially and then titrated upwards.
*Treatment should be time limited and regularly reviewed (every 3 months
or according to clinical need).
*Risperidone is the only antipsychotic drug licensed for treating
dementia-related behavioural disturbances; it is indicated for short
term use (up to 6 weeks), for persistent aggression in Alzheimer’s
dementia, unresponsive to non-drug approaches.
*Both Risperidone and Olanzapine have the best evidence base for
effectiveness compared with placebo for physical aggression,
agitation and psychosis
NICE GUIDELINES for managing
BPSD

*Occasional lapses of memory are common, especially in
the presence of physical illness or stress—if in doubt, offer
to see someone again in three months
*If you ask a patient a simple question and they immediately
turn their head to the spouse, suspect dementia
*If you suspect dementia, take a history from an informant
*Have a low threshold for referring someone to a memory
clinic if you suspect he or she may have dementia
*Always consider dementia when seeing a patient,
especially an older patient who complains of memory
problems
*Generally, memory problems developing over days are
due to vascular disease, over weeks are due to depression,
and over months are due to dementia
TIPS FOR NON-SPECIALISTS
